[0002] Auxiliary absorbent articles (inner pads) are known that are placed on the inner surface (the surface facing the wearer's skin) of absorbent articles such as disposable diapers (hereinafter referred to as diapers, etc.). Some inner pads are provided with fastening means on their outer surface that holds the inner pad in a predetermined position on the inner surface of the diaper, etc. The fastening means is formed, for example, from the male component of a hook-and-loop fastener, and is held in place by engaging with the nonwoven fabric sheet on the inner surface of the diaper, etc. Inner pads that do not have fastening means are held on the inner surface of the diaper, etc. by the frictional force between the contacting surfaces.

[0003] Diapers and the like are formed by connecting a dorsal portion, a crotch portion, and a ventral portion along the longitudinal direction. There are two types of diapers: the so-called pants type, in which the dorsal portion and the ventral portion are connected in advance to form a covering portion around the wearer's waist; and the so-called tape type, in which the dorsal portion, the crotch portion, and the ventral portion are spread out in the longitudinal direction, covering the wearer's buttocks with the dorsal portion, the crotch portion with the crotch portion, and the lower abdomen with the ventral portion, and the both sides of the dorsal portion and both sides of the ventral portion are connected with tape.

[0004] When the wearer or an assistant (hereinafter referred to as the "wearer") places an inner pad in a tape-type diaper, it is necessary to position the inner pad evenly on both sides of the width of the diaper, so that it is not biased to one side in the width direction. If the inner pad is positioned biased to one side in the width direction, excrement is more likely to leak from the inner pad into the diaper.

[0005] Therefore, a technique has been proposed in which a pair of visible colored markings corresponding to two corners at one end of an absorbent pad (auxiliary absorbent article) are arranged at positions symmetrical about the center line in the width direction on the inner surface of the back side of a diaper or the like (see, for example, Patent Document 1). This technique aligns the two corners at one end of the absorbent pad in the longitudinal direction with the corresponding pair of colored markings, thereby enabling the absorbent pad to be positioned in a predetermined position on a diaper or the like, and ensuring that the absorbent pad is positioned without any deviation in the width direction or length direction. [Prior art documents] [Patent documents]

[0006] [Patent Document 1] Patent No. 4796867 Summary of the Invention [Problem to be solved by the invention]

[0007] However, the technology disclosed in Patent Document 1 forms colored markings corresponding to the four corners of the diaper, so it is necessary to adjust the posture and position of the absorbent pad so that each of the four corners of the absorbent pad is aligned with the colored markings. In other words, this technology aligns the diaper and absorbent pad at multiple points that are spaced apart from each other, and alignment must be performed while simultaneously checking multiple points. Therefore, this technology has the problem of difficulty in alignment, such as the absorbent pad easily becoming tilted relative to the diaper.

DETAILED DESCRIPTION OF THE INVENTION

[0012] Embodiments of the absorbent article according to the present invention will be described below with reference to the drawings.

[0013] <Tape-type disposable diapers> Fig. 1 is a plan view of a tape-type disposable diaper 100 (hereinafter referred to as diaper 100) as seen from the side that comes into contact with the wearer's skin (the inner surface of diaper 100), Fig. 2 is a back view of diaper 100 as seen from the side opposite the wearer's skin (the outer surface of diaper 100), and Fig. 3 is a cross-sectional view taken along line AA in Fig. 1, i.e., a cross-section of crotch region 120 taken along width direction W perpendicular to longitudinal direction L. The illustrated diaper 100 is one embodiment of an absorbent article according to the present invention.

[0014] 1 and 2, the diaper 100 is formed by connecting a dorsal portion 110, a crotch portion 120, and a ventral portion 130 along the longitudinal direction L. As shown in Fig. 3, the diaper 100 is formed by stacking a gathered sheet 50, a top sheet 10, an absorbent body 30, a polyethylene sheet 40, and a back sheet 20 in the thickness direction D, starting from the side that comes into contact with the wearer's skin (the inner surface of the diaper 100).

[0015] The top sheet 10 is a sheet that comes into contact with the wearer's skin when the diaper 100 is worn by the wearer. The top sheet 10 is an example of a surface sheet in an absorbent article according to the present invention. In the back-side portion 110 and the ventral-side portion 130, the top sheet 10 does not extend over the entire width direction W, but extends only to the outer regions in the width direction W immediately adjacent to a line S1, which is a marking described below. However, the top sheet 10 may extend over the entire width direction W, in which case the top sheet 10 is formed to have the same shape as the outer shape of the diaper 100 shown in FIG. 1.

[0016] The top sheet 10 is formed of a liquid-permeable, perforated or non-perforated nonwoven fabric or a porous plastic sheet. Due to this liquid permeability, the top sheet 10 allows moisture from the wearer's excrement to pass through in the thickness direction D and transfer to the absorbent body 30 located below the top sheet 10 (on the outer surface in the thickness direction D).

[0017] The absorber 30 is provided in the longitudinal direction L over a portion of the back portion 110, the entire length of the crotch portion 120, and a portion of the abdominal portion 130. The absorber 30 is formed of an absorbent member 31 and crepe paper 32. The absorbent member 31 is made of pulp fibers intertwined with and distributed superabsorbent polymers (SAP), and absorbs and retains moisture.

[0018] The crepe paper 32 wraps the absorbent member 31 inside and maintains a fixed shape as the absorbent body 30. The crepe paper 32 is made of, for example, a liquid-permeable nonwoven fabric, and transfers moisture that has permeated the top sheet 10 to the absorbent member 31.

[0019] The polyethylene sheet 40 is an example of an intermediate sheet in the absorbent article according to the present invention. The polyethylene sheet 40 may be formed in a shape having the same width as the outer shape of the diaper 100, which is the product, or may be formed in a shape having approximately the same width as the top sheet 10. The polyethylene sheet 40 is made of liquid-impermeable polyethylene, and prevents moisture that has permeated the top sheet 10 and moisture held by the absorbent body 30 from permeating in the thickness direction D of the polyethylene sheet 40.

[0020] The intermediate sheet in the absorbent article according to the present invention is not limited to the polyethylene sheet 40, but may be a sheet made of a liquid-impermeable resin material such as polypropylene.

[0021] In addition, the absorbent article of the present invention only requires that at least one of the intermediate sheet and the outer sheet be made of a liquid-impermeable material, and that moisture that has permeated the inner sheet or moisture that cannot be retained by the absorbent body is not allowed to permeate through the intermediate sheet or outer sheet, thereby preventing moisture from permeating to the outside of the outer sheet.

[0022] The backsheet 20 is the outermost sheet of the diaper 100 when the diaper 100 is worn by a wearer. The backsheet 20 is an example of an outer sheet in the absorbent article according to the present invention. The backsheet 20 forms the outer shape of the diaper 100 shown in Fig. 2. The backsheet 20 is made of, for example, a nonwoven fabric.

[0023] 1 and 3, the gathered sheet 50 is disposed closer to the wearer's skin than the top sheet 10. The gathered sheet 50 is provided in both side regions in the width direction W of the diaper 100, excluding the central region where the absorber 30 is disposed, overlapping both end portions of the backsheet 20 in the width direction W.

[0024] Therefore, in the diaper 100, the top sheet 10 comes into contact with the wearer's skin in the central region in the width direction W where the absorber 30 is arranged, and the gathered sheet 50 comes into contact with the wearer's skin in the region outside the center in the width direction W where the absorber 30 is not arranged.

[0025] As shown in Fig. 3, each of the two gathered sheets 50 is formed such that a region 50b on the central side in the width direction W is not joined to the top sheet 10. Furthermore, each gathered sheet 50 has rubber thread 51 (an example of an elastic member) extending along the longitudinal direction L at an end portion 50a on the central side in the width direction W in the crotch region 120. The rubber thread 51 is joined to the gathered sheet 50 in a state stretched more than in its natural state.

[0026] Therefore, when a wearer puts on the diaper 100, the crotch region 120 curves along the wearer's body, and the restoring force (elastic force) of the rubber threads 51 causes the central region 50b of the gathered sheet 50 in the width direction W to rise up from the top sheet 10 toward the wearer's skin. The end portions 50a of the raised gathered sheet 50 come into close contact with the wearer's groin, preventing leakage from around the legs of the diaper 100.

[0027] On both sides of the back portion 110 of the diaper 100, two fastening tapes 60 are provided at different positions in the longitudinal direction, for joining each side of the back portion 110 to the abdominal portion 130 when the diaper 100 is worn by a wearer. The diaper 100 is not limited to having two fastening tapes 60 on each side, but may have one fastening tape 60 on each side. The central portions of these fastening tapes 60 in the width direction W are fixed to the back portion 110 with the central portions sandwiched between the gathered sheet 40 and the back sheet 20.

[0028] The fastening tape 60 is a portion that protrudes outward in the width direction W from the top sheet 10 and the back sheet 20, and a hook member of the surface fastener is provided on the surface facing the wearer's skin side. The fastening tape 60 is fixed to the ventral part 130 by engaging the hook member thereof with the back sheet 20 in the ventral part 130.

[0029] Then, by fixing the fastening tapes 60 of the dorsal part 110 to the ventral part 130 respectively, the dorsal part 110 and the ventral part 130 are connected, and the edge Ln in the longitudinal direction L of the dorsal part 110 and the edge Lm in the longitudinal direction L of the ventral part 130 are connected in the circumferential direction, forming a body circumference opening corresponding to the wearer's body circumference. At the same time, both side edges Li and Lj of the crotch part 120 are connected in the circumferential direction respectively, forming an opening around the wearer's legs.

[0030] <Inner Pad> FIG. 4 is a plan view showing the first inner pad 200, FIG. 5 is a plan view showing the second inner pad 300, and FIG. 6 is a plan view showing the third inner pad 400. As shown in FIG. 4, the first inner pad 200 is formed in a rectangular shape with a width W1 and a length L1. As shown in FIG. 5, the second inner pad 300 is formed in a rectangular shape with a width W1 and a length L2 (<L1). As shown in FIG. 6, the third inner pad 400 is formed in a rectangular shape with a width W2 (<W1) and a length L3 (<L2).

[0031] That is, the first inner pad 200 and the second inner pad 300 are formed with the same width W1, but the first inner pad 200 is formed longer than the second inner pad 300. The third inner pad 400 is formed with a width W2 smaller than the first inner pad 200 and the second inner pad 300, and a length L3 shorter than the second inner pad 300.

[0032] The first inner pad 200, the second inner pad 300, and the third inner pad 400 are all auxiliary absorbent articles that are placed on the inner surface of the diaper 100. Although not shown, the first inner pad 200, the second inner pad 300, and the third inner pad 400 may each be provided with a fastening member on the back surface shown in the drawing, which engages with the top sheet 10 of the diaper 100. The fastening member may be, for example, a hook member of a hook-and-loop fastener, similar to the fastening tape 60 described above, or may be an adhesive member.

[0033] The first inner pad 200 is used for long periods of time, for example, at night, the second inner pad 300 is used for shorter periods of time than the first inner pad 200, for example, during the day, and the third inner pad 400 is used as a low-absorbency type with less absorption than the second inner pad 300.

[0034] (Width alignment mark) 1 and 2, the polyethylene sheet 40 has a plurality of lines S1, S2, S3, and S0 that extend linearly along the longitudinal direction L from both end edges Ln and Lm in the longitudinal direction L and are drawn in a color different from the base material. The base material of the polyethylene sheet 40 is, for example, transparent or white, and the lines S1, S2, S3, and S0 are formed in, for example, light blue. The color of the lines S1, S2, S3, and S0 is not limited to light blue.

[0035] These lines S1, S2, S3, and S0 extend continuously from the dorsal portion 110 to the ventral portion 130 along the longitudinal direction L. The lines S1, S2, S3, and S0 may be formed on the inner surface or the outer surface of the polyethylene sheet 40, but are formed so as to be visible from both the inner surface and the outer surface.

[0036] In addition, for the diaper 100, the top sheet 10 is formed of white or a color with a higher brightness than the lines S1, S2, S3, S0 so as to optically transmit each of the lines S1, S2, S3, S0 formed on the polyethylene sheet 40. Therefore, as shown in FIG. 1, the diaper 100 allows each of the lines S1, S2, S3, S0 to be visually recognized from the inner surface side of the diaper 100.

[0037] Similarly, for the diaper 100, the back sheet 20 is formed of white or a color with a higher brightness than the lines S1, S2, S3, S0 so as to optically transmit each of the lines S1, S2, S3, S0 formed on the polyethylene sheet 40. Therefore, as shown in FIG. 2, the diaper 100 allows each of the lines S1, S2, S3, S0 to be visually recognized from the outer surface side of the diaper 100.

[0038] Note that for the diaper 100, the absorber 30 is formed of a color different from the lines S1, S2, S3, S0, for example, white. The diaper 100 is formed with a width WK (<W2) that does not cover the lines S1, S2 formed on the polyethylene sheet 40, and the width WK is wider than the width W3 between the lines S3 (W3 <WK).

[0039] Therefore, as shown in FIG. 1, the diaper 100 allows the lines S1, S2 to be visually recognized over the entire length from the inner surface side of the diaper 100. However, since the absorber 30 covers a part of the lines S3, S0, the lines S3, S0 can be visually recognized only in the region where the absorber 30 is not arranged in the longitudinal direction L from the inner surface side of the diaper 100.

[0040] The line S0 overlaps with the center line C in the width direction W of the diaper 100 and is formed with a thick line width with the center line C as the center of line symmetry. The line S0 is a mark indicating the center in the width direction W of the diaper 100.

[0041] Two lines S3 are formed outside the line S0 at positions symmetrical to each other across the center line C. The two lines S3 are formed at a position of width W3 between the lines along the width direction W. The lines S3 are marks that indicate a guide for aligning the fastening tape 60 in the width direction W when engaging the fastening tape 60 with the back sheet 20 of the abdominal portion 130.

[0042] That is, the lines S3 and S0 serve as guides for engaging the left and right fastening tapes 60 at equal positions in the width direction W. The two lines S3 are partially hidden by the absorbent body 30 on the inner surface of the diaper 100, but are not partially hidden on the outer surface, so there is no problem when engaging the fastening tapes 60 with the backsheet 20 of the abdominal portion 130.

[0043] Two lines S2 are formed outside the line S3 at positions symmetrical to each other across the center line C. The two lines S2 are formed at a distance W2 (>W3) between them along the width direction W. The width W2 between the two lines S2 matches the width W2 of the third inner pad 400 (see FIG. 6).

[0044] In other words, the line S2 is a positioning mark for arranging the third inner pad 400 in the appropriate position in the width direction W when placing it on the inner side of the diaper 100. Here, the appropriate position in the width direction W is a position that is evenly spaced on both sides of the center line C in the width direction W. Therefore, by placing the third inner pad 400 with both side edges 401 of the third inner pad 400 aligned with the line S2, the third inner pad 400 can be placed in the appropriate position in the width direction W on the inner side of the diaper 100, and it is possible to prevent the third inner pad 400 from being placed unevenly to the left or right.

[0045] Furthermore, this line S2 serves as a marker for aligning the line that is the side edge 401 of the third inner pad 400 along the entire length of the side edge 401, making the alignment process easier and improving the accuracy of alignment compared to aligning multiple points that are far from each other.

[0046] Two lines S1 are formed outside line S2 at positions symmetrical to each other across center line C. The two lines S1 are formed at a position with a width W1 (>W2) between them (between the inner edges of line S1) along the width direction W. The width W1 between the two lines S1 matches the width W1 of the first inner pad 200 (see FIG. 4) and the second inner pad 300 (see FIG. 5).

[0047] In other words, the line S1 is a positioning mark for arranging the first inner pad 200 or the second inner pad 300 at the appropriate position in the width direction W when arranging the first inner pad 200 or the second inner pad 300 on the inner side of the diaper 100.

[0048] Therefore, by positioning the first inner pad 200 with both side edges 201 of the first inner pad 200 aligned with the line S1, the first inner pad 200 can be positioned at an appropriate position in the width direction W on the inner side of the diaper 100, preventing it from being positioned unevenly to the left or right. Similarly, by positioning the second inner pad 300 with both side edges 301 of the second inner pad 300 aligned with the line S1, the second inner pad 300 can be positioned at an appropriate position in the width direction W on the inner side of the diaper 100, preventing it from being positioned unevenly to the left or right.

[0049] Furthermore, since line S1 serves as a marker for aligning the line that is the side edge 201 of the first inner pad 200 along the entire length of the side edge 201, or the line that is the side edge 301 of the second inner pad 300 along the entire length of the side edge 301, the alignment work is made easier and the alignment accuracy can be improved compared to alignment that involves matching multiple points that are distant from each other.

[0050] Furthermore, the line S1 is formed to have a wider line width (line width) than the line S2. Therefore, when the first inner pad 200 or the second inner pad 300 having the width W1 is arranged in the diaper 100, the wearer or the like can recognize that the pair of two wide lines S1 is the line along which the side edge 201 of the first inner pad 200 or the side edge 301 of the second inner pad 300 should be aligned.

[0051] On the other hand, when the diaper 100 is placed with a third inner pad 400 of width W2, the wearer or the like can recognize that the pair of two narrow lines S2 are the lines along which the side edges 401 of the third inner pad 400 should be aligned.

[0052] In this way, the diaper 100 has two lines that should form a pair (a pair of lines S1 and S1, or a pair of lines S2 and S2) that have the same line width, but the line widths differ between the two pairs, so that the pair of lines that should form a pair can be correctly recognized by the wearer, etc.

[0053] The diaper 100 is not limited to a configuration in which the lines S1 and S2 are distinguished by differences in line width, but may be a configuration in which the lines S1 and S2 are distinguished by differences in brightness of the same color. Although the diaper 100 does not exclude a configuration in which the lines S1 and S2 are distinguished by differences in color (hue), a configuration in which the lines S1 and S2 are distinguished by differences in color complicates the manufacturing process of the diaper 100 compared to a configuration in which the lines S1 and S2 are distinguished by differences in brightness of a single color, so a configuration in which the lines S1 and S2 are distinguished by differences in brightness of a single color is preferable.

[0054] FIG. 7 is a plan view illustrating a more preferred aspect of the diaper 100 of embodiment 1, FIG. 8 is a cross-sectional view taken along line BB in FIG. 7, and FIG. 9 is a view showing details of part E in FIG.

[0055] As shown in Fig. 1, the absorber 30 of the diaper 100 is formed with a width WK that does not obscure the line S2 that serves as a marker for the position of the third inner pad 400. Therefore, the width W of the absorber 30 is narrower than that of conventional diapers in which this marker line S2 is not formed. Furthermore, the diaper 100 has a lower rigidity against bending in the thickness direction D than that of conventional diapers in which the width W of the absorber 30 does not have the line S2 formed.

[0056] When the diaper 100 is provided as a product, it is folded inward in the thickness direction D along lines Lp and Lq extending in the width direction W, i.e., folded into thirds, as shown in Fig. 7. When the diaper 100 is folded into thirds, the fold line Lp extending in the width direction W is formed at a position that substantially coincides with, for example, the boundary line between the abdominal portion 130 and the crotch portion 120 in the longitudinal direction L, and the fold line Lq extending in the width direction W is formed at a position that substantially coincides with, for example, the boundary line between the dorsal portion 110 and the crotch portion 120 in the longitudinal direction L.

[0057] In the diaper 100, the rubber threads 51 provided on the gathered sheet 50 are arranged along the longitudinal direction L, spanning from the back side portion 110 to the ventral side portion 130, and the restoring force of the rubber threads 51 acts on the crotch portion 120, tending to deflect the crotch portion 120 in the thickness direction D. At this time, the absorber 30 in the crotch portion 120 has lower rigidity than conventional diapers, and therefore there is a risk that it will bend significantly in the thickness direction D due to the restoring force of the rubber threads 51.

[0058] When the crotch region 120 is bent, the lines S1 and S2, which are marks for the proper placement positions of the inner pads 200, 300, and 400, become curved rather than straight. When the lines S1 and S2 are curved, it becomes difficult to align the side edges 201, 301, and 401 of the inner pads 200, 300, and 400.

[0059] 8, the diaper 100 is configured such that the region 30a of the absorber 30 corresponding to the crotch region 120, which is prone to bending, has higher rigidity than the regions 30b and 30c outside the lines Lp and Lq in the longitudinal direction L. Specifically, the regions 30b and 30c outside the lines Lp and Lq of the absorber 30 are formed of a single layer of absorbent member 31, whereas the region 30a corresponding to the crotch region 120 is formed of a two-layer absorbent member 31. The two-layer absorbent member 31 has higher bending rigidity than the single-layer absorbent member 31.

[0060] The absorbent body 30 is formed with high rigidity in the region 30a corresponding to the crotch region 120, which makes it difficult for the crotch region 120 to bend, and the lines S1 and S2 tend to maintain a straight line. Therefore, the diaper 100 can prevent difficulty in aligning the side edges 201, 301, and 401 of the inner pads 200, 300, and 400.

[0061] In addition, the configuration for increasing the rigidity of the region 30a of the absorbent body 30 corresponding to the crotch region 120 may be achieved by making the width of the region 30a corresponding to the crotch region 120 wider than the width of the regions 30b, 30c outside the lines Lp, Lq, in addition to the above-mentioned two-layer structure of the absorbent member 31.

[0062] In addition, the configuration for increasing the rigidity of the region 30a of the absorbent body 30 corresponding to the crotch region 120 may be achieved by increasing the density of the absorbent member 31 in the region 30a corresponding to the crotch region 120 to be higher than the density of the absorbent member 31 in the regions 30b, 30c outside the lines Lp, Lq, thereby increasing the basis weight.

[0063] The diaper 100 may employ a configuration in which, instead of increasing the rigidity of the region 30a of the absorber 30 corresponding to the crotch region 120, the restoring force of the rubber thread 51 acting on the crotch region 120 is reduced. Specifically, as shown in Fig. 9, in the diaper 100, the rubber thread 51 is cut at the portions where it intersects with the line Lq and the line Lp (not shown). This reduces the restoring force of the rubber thread 51 in the region 30a corresponding to the crotch region 120.

[0064] The diaper 100 configured in this manner makes it difficult for the crotch region 120 to bend, and the lines S1 and S2 tend to remain aligned, similar to the diaper 100 configured with increased rigidity in the region 30a corresponding to the crotch region 120. Therefore, the diaper 100 can prevent difficulty in aligning the side edges 201, 301, and 401 of the inner pads 200, 300, and 400.

[0065] (Longitudinal alignment mark (second mark)) Figure 10 is a plan view showing a portion of the diaper 100 where a line 32a serving as a mark (second mark) for aligning the first inner pad 200 in the longitudinal direction L and a line 31a serving as a mark (second mark) for aligning the second inner pad 300 in the longitudinal direction L are formed, and Figure 11 is a cross-sectional view showing a cross section along line FF in Figure 10.

[0066] As described above, the diaper 100 is formed with lines S1 and S2 that serve as markers for alignment in the width direction W when placing the first inner pad 200, the second inner pad 300, or the third inner pad 400. Since the first inner pad 200 and the second inner pad 300 are formed with the same width W1, alignment in the width direction W can be achieved by aligning the side edges 201 and 301 with the inner edges of the marker line S1.

[0067] On the other hand, the first inner pad 200 and the second inner pad 300 have different lengths, which are sizes along the longitudinal direction L, and the length L2 of the second inner pad 300 is shorter than the length L1 of the first inner pad 200. Therefore, it is difficult for a wearer or the like to recognize the proper position in the longitudinal direction L when placing the first inner pad 200 or the second inner pad 300 in the diaper 100.

[0068] Therefore, as shown in Figure 10, it is preferable that the diaper 100 is formed with a line 32a, which is a second marker along which one end edge 202 (see Figure 4) of the first inner pad 200 in the longitudinal direction L should be aligned when the first inner pad 200 is positioned in the appropriate position in the longitudinal direction L, and a line 31a, which is a second marker along which one end edge 302 (see Figure 5) of the second inner pad 300 in the longitudinal direction L should be aligned when the second inner pad 300 is positioned in the appropriate position in the longitudinal direction L.

[0069] Here, the lines 32a and 31a, which are the second marks shown in Fig. 10, are both lines parallel to the width direction W of the diaper 100. The lines 32a and 31a are formed by the absorbent body 30, as shown in Fig. 11, for example. Specifically, the absorbent body 30 is composed of an absorbent member 31 and crepe paper 32, but the end of the absorbent body 30 on the back side portion 110 side in the longitudinal direction L is formed only by the crepe paper 32, which is not filled with the absorbent member 31. The crepe paper 32 is formed in a color, for example, white, that allows the line S0 to be optically transmitted.

[0070] The length along the longitudinal direction L of the end of this absorbent body 30, which is formed only by crepe paper 32, is set to be the same as the difference ΔL (= L1 - L2) between the length L1 of the first inner pad 200 and the length L2 of the second inner pad 300.

[0071] In other words, the end of the absorbent body 30, which is an area of ​​length ΔL from the upper edge 32a shown in the figure, is formed only from crepe paper 32, and the area below the lower edge 31a of that end is filled with absorbent member 31.

[0072] The edge of the absorbent body 30 formed only of crepe paper 32 optically transmits the line S0 formed in the polyethylene sheet 40 placed under the absorbent body 30, as shown in FIG.

[0073] As a result, the line S0 formed on the polyethylene sheet 40 is visible through the top sheet 10 and the crepe paper 32 in the region above the edge 32a of the crepe paper 32 in the illustrations (FIGS. 10 and 11). The line S0 appears relatively darker above the edge 32a and relatively lighter below the edge 32a, and this difference in color enables the wearer to recognize the edge 32a as a line 32a extending in the width direction W.

[0074] Therefore, the diaper 100 can be formed with the line 32a as a second mark indicating the proper position where the first inner pad 200 should be placed with the end edge 202 in the longitudinal direction L aligned.

[0075] Furthermore, the line S0 formed on the polyethylene sheet 40 is visible through the top sheet 10 and the crepe paper 32 in the region above the edge 31a as shown in the figure, but is hidden by the absorbent member 31 and is not visible in the region below the edge 31a.

[0076] As a result, the line S0 is visible above the edge 31a and not visible below the edge 31a, allowing the wearer to recognize the edge 31a as a line 31a extending in the width direction W.

[0077] Therefore, the diaper 100 can be formed with the line 31a as a second mark indicating the proper position where the second inner pad 300 should be placed with the end edge 302 in the longitudinal direction L aligned.

[0078] In the above-described diaper 100, the second marks 32a, 31a are formed by the difference in optical transmittance utilizing the overlap between the line S0 formed on the polyethylene sheet and the absorbent body 30, but the second marks 32a, 31a may also be formed in other ways utilizing the overlap between the line S0 formed on the polyethylene sheet and the absorbent body 30.

[0079] Figure 12 shows an example of a diaper in which lines 34, 35 serving as second marks are formed by forming part of the contour shape of the absorbent body 30 in a sawtooth shape. When the absorbent body 30 is placed over a line S0 of a different color from the absorbent body 30, which is formed on a polyethylene sheet 40, the lines 34, 35 of the absorbent body 30 can be seen with good optical contrast.

[0080] Therefore, in a diaper formed in this manner, line 34 can be used as a second marker indicating the position of length L4 along the longitudinal direction L, and line 35 can be used as a second marker indicating the position of length L5 along the longitudinal direction L.

[0081] Figure 13 shows an example of a diaper in which part of the outline of the line S0 formed on the polyethylene sheet 40 is formed in a wavy line shape, so that the wavy line is recessed inward in the line width direction (the same as the width direction W), and the position of the narrowed portion 42 in the width direction W is formed as the second mark. In the diaper constructed in this manner, the straight side edge of the absorbent body 30 is overlapped with a line S0 of a different color from the absorbent body 30 formed on the polyethylene sheet 40, and the narrowed portion of the wavy line in the line S0 can be recognized by the wearer or the like as a line 37 extending along the width direction W.

[0082] Therefore, in a diaper formed in this manner, line 36, which is the edge of the upper end of absorbent body 30, can be used as a second marker indicating the position of length L6 along the longitudinal direction L, and line 37 can be used as a second marker indicating the position of length L7 along the longitudinal direction L.
